We are seeking an experienced Commissioning Engineer with National Grid TP141 Authorisation to join our team. The role involves the commissioning of SCADA and Protection systems across National Grid sites throughout England. This is an exciting opportunity for a skilled engineer looking to contribute to high-profile power projects.

  • Commissioning of Protection and Control system: Lead and support the commissioning process for SCS and Protection installations on National Grid sites. Ensure all work is completed in accordance with relevant standards and safety regulations. Perform testing and fault diagnosis on the Protection and Control system. Prepare and review commissioning documentation, including test reports and certificates. Prepare the relevant commissioning folder and schedules. Understanding and support of the CSP plan for system return.
  • Collaboration with Site Teams: Work closely with project managers, engineers, and contractors to ensure project timelines are met. Provide technical guidance to site teams and offer troubleshooting support.
  • Health and Safety Compliance: Adhere to all site-specific health and safety procedures and risk assessments. Ensure safe working practices are maintained throughout the commissioning process.
  • Reporting and Documentation: Document commissioning activities and report progress to management. Ensure all relevant data is accurately logged and signed off as per client requirements.
  • Customer Liaison: Liaise with clients, including National Grid, to ensure successful project delivery, including commissioning panel meetings. Address any client concerns promptly and professionally.

Required Qualifications and Experience:

  • Essential: Proven experience in commissioning SCADA and Protection systems, preferably in power transmission projects. Strong knowledge of electrical systems and controls associated with transmission systems. Strong knowledge on networking, managed switches, time synch protocols. Strong knowledge on related functionalities for ATCC, Synchrocheck and other. Strong knowledge on communication protocols, such as IEC61850. Familiarity with National Grid commissioning procedures and industry standards. Experience working on National Grid sites. Ability to understand and fault find the electrical scheme design. Valid driver license.
  • Desirable: National Grid TP141 Authorisation. Experience working on SCADA systems such as PACiS, DsAgile, GPG, G500. Experience working on Protection schemes, such as DAR, mesh corner, Feeder, Transformer, Busbar.
